Output 9af2b8459c253488816e518eae59ef02b62846a5c5c6a41658e0258663dce1f4:0

value
18247434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e000ee71f204d92469defa778cc7674f69f00ea OP_EQUAL
address
3G6Sku2HHrrUQ7BA34aB3Bh2qAixKKreLh
transaction
9af2b8459c253488816e518eae59ef02b62846a5c5c6a41658e0258663dce1f4
confirmations
315135
spent
true